Kanchanjunga
(The Glorious Trek)
Out of all the world's great peaks, Kanchanjunga, the 3rd
highest at 28,168ft. is the least known and least visited.
Astride the Nepal/Sikkim border, only a few miles from Tibet,
it lies in a sensitive area with restriction facing those
who approach it from any quarter. We have planned our tour
to avoid the restricted area as far as possible with the Yalung
glacier immediately to the south of Kanchanjunga, our main
objective.
Our trek takes us initially over Mahabharat lekh range with
a grand view of both the Everest and kanchanjunga massifs
divided by the deep. Arun valley, one of the few wildlife
which forces its way through Himalayan range. Intensely cultivated
hill sides dominate the landscape as we move north into Nepal
midlands, inhabited mainly by Rais and Limbus settlers. To
reach Simbua khola, we climb steadily through pine and rhododendron
forest the yak pasture below the flakier At 14,000 ft, 0ne
is almost surrounded by peaks Jannu (25,294ft) Kanchanjunga,
Kumbhakarna, Kabru and Ratong. The return route takes us west
through some delightful villages to the central region of
Taplejung. There is an easy walk down to the road head and
superb views of Everest, Makalu and Kanchanjunga
